“”UPDATE”” Faries is in custody.

Early this morning, April 20, 2026, at approximately 2:00 AM, Brently Faries escaped from custody while receiving medical treatment at Haskell County Hospital, just prior to being booked into jail on multiple charges.

If you have any information regarding his whereabouts, contact The Haskell County Sheriff’s Office immediately at 919-967-2400.

:Statement From The Sheriff:

Regarding the ongoing posts about the incident that occurred last night.

The situation in the area at the time was dynamic, and due to a second call in the same general area, deputies responded accordingly based on the information available to them. Ultimately, the two calls were determined to be related in nature. The 2nd call was in regards to an individual who, we were told, had made statements to “self harm by police”.

No one was taken to jail, and Mr. Suttles was only briefly detained for officer safety. We sincerely apologize if the response caused concern; however, the actions taken were necessary to ensure the safety of both the public and our deputies while addressing the calls for service.

WINTER WEATHER ADVISORY – HASKELL COUNTY

Deputies will be available to assist during this potentially dangerous weather event.

Call 911 only for emergencies, including medical issues, motorists in immediate danger from the cold, or situations involving violence or threats to life.

If you must travel:

• Slow down and leave extra space
• Avoid sudden braking or sharp turns
• Use caution on bridges and overpasses
• Turn on headlights
• Carry basic emergency supplies

Road conditions can change quickly. Stay alert and stay safe.
